Course Description
This course develops advanced writing skills for composing referenced academic research papers in English literary studies and teaches students how to structure and support arguments. The course will use a variety of source texts and exercises as practical examples and will be assessed by coursework.
Intended Learning Outcomes
CILO-1: Evaluate existing critical literature, devise research questions and suggest appropriate intellectual approaches.
CILO-2: Identify, plan and conduct original academic research in their field.
CILO-3: Effectively present research findings in scholarly writing.
CILO-4: Effectively communicate research findings through presentations.
CILO-5: Demonstrate a commitment to continuous learning and an awareness of how to engage respectfully and effectively within the academic community.
